    I'm going to guess Jade Shuriken, some if it's a bit of a stretch, but here's my reasoning.

    I come with a small body on field - [Summons a Jade Golem, which starts out as a small 1/1 body]

    My namesake is something to wield - [A shuriken is a weapon to be wielded, this was the main line that differentiated it from other Jade cards for me, though this could also apply to Jade Claws, but the text refers to "namesake" specifically, not card type]

    Out of context, I shouldn't exist - [Traditionally, shuriken are made from cheap, expendable metals. Jade by contrast would have been incredibly expensive to use in such weaponry, and provides no benefit, thus out of the context of Hearthstone, it wouldn't exist]

    My effect is a chronological hitch - [The summoning effect gets stronger chronologically as you play more Jade cards, not sure about the "hitch" part though...]

    Screaming faces in billowing green - [Looking over all the art for Jade cards, none feature screaming faces, but the Jade Golem token art itself does, when it reaches 20/20 and above]

    My predecessor vanished, but I'll never leave - [The Jade Lotus is animating each Jade Golem with a portion of Kun the Forgotten King's soul, making him their predecessor, and he vanished long ago and, true to his name, was forgotten]

    Sir Thomas of the Silver Hand was once a noble knight, but through the machinations of Balnazzar the Dreadlord, he was broken and twisted into the maddened abomination you see before you. Now, he returns every Hallow's End, to wreak terrifying chaos upon the villages of Azeroth...

    ... But what's even more frightening is that he won't stop reciting his terrible poetry!

     

    The Headless Horseman acts similarly to Kazakus, though instead of crafting a spell to use at a later date, you craft an effect that happens immediately upon playing the card, almost like a Swampqueen Hagatha token.

    You would Discover twice, to create a unique effect for the situation. The poems are generally themed around: Building a board, dealing with an enemy board, or utility, with there being two choices for each category. The poem options are laid out below.
